मशाल



वह  जलाया गया बच्चा
जो कल दिन में मर गया
मुझे रात भर परेशान करता रहा .

 दांत भींचे
अपने दर्द को दबाते हुए
पूछता रहा लगातार
क्या ग्यारह मरने की सही उम्र है ?

मेरे हाथ में ना बन्दूक थी
ना कोई हथियार
ना बलिष्ठ काया
ना ही आतंकी इरादा
जिन्दा जला दिया गया
फिर भी
निर्बल था मैं
क्या निर्बलता की मुझे मिली सजा .

अच्छा किया
नहीं मारा मुझे बन्दुक की गोली से
नहीं कुचला
भारी-भरकम कील ठुंके बूट से
नहीं क़त्ल किया
विष चुभे खंजर से
जलाया मुझे आग में
लपलपाती आग
असहनीय पीड़ा झेलते जल गया मैं


आग की लपटों में
जलता जिन्दा  शरीर
मशाल बन मरता है
पर सोचता हूँ
क्या मैं बन पाउँगा मशाल
निहत्थे का
निरीह का
न्याय  का
शहर समाज के हर निर्बल गरीब का .

~~~ रामानुज दुबे

Cineplay



Today Evening I saw CinePlay ‘The Job’ at La-Makaan, Hyderabad. As per the advertisement of the organizer, CinePlay is the novel mode of theatre. The advertisement says, “CinePlay is a new genre of entertainment. It is a cinematic experience of theatrical production. The film making process is used to convey meaningful stories, in collaboration with the theatre director’s vision. A new language of cinema. It’s cinema, it’s theatre, it’s cineplay”.

What is CinePlay ?

CinePlay is a hybrid form of theatre and cinema. A play is recorded aesthetically then some film making elements are used to present video version of play to the audience. It is neither theatre nor cinema. Theatre has immediacy that immediacy you miss in CinePlay, as CinePlay is restricted to set design as per the play so it is hard to get the pleasure of film. CinePlay does not provide big canvass as cinema. It is devoid of complete pleasure of film & theatre.

Then what is the use of this format?

CinePlay does not provide the all elements of theatre and cinema to the audiences; it does not mean that it is a useless format. When a group performs a play, it undergoes a very arduous process from rehearsal to stage performance.  Director works on script, actors, set, light, music, blocking, stylization, costume etc. Actors work on characterization, speech, gesture, posture, diction, chemistry with co-actors etc. Once the play is ready, it reaches to audience.  Generally, any medium size good auditorium in any town/ city has two hundred to three hundred sitting capacity. If a group conducts ten shows, it will have maximum reach to two thousand to three thousand people. For every performance group will have to conduct rehearsal, booking of auditorium, coordination with organizer/ producer.  Sometimes costs of these efforts become quite huge than returns. Regular shows of any play needs dedicated director, disciplined actors, functional group, good public relations with all stake holders, sufficient resources be it – human or finance. CinePlay is the shortcut solution to such problem. Do a play, get it recorded, put some elements of cinema to enhance the quality of the play and conduct the show when audience is ready.  CinePlay does not require theatre or auditorium, it can be shown anywhere, and it requires a projector and laptop. Cineplay can have wider reach to audience than the actual play but it will never be as effective as play. CinePlay can also act as the documentation of play and it can be shown to audience/ public even after a long time.

Is cinePlay a new genre of entertainment?

No. CinePlay not a new concept, not a new genre of entertainment.  In fact, Doordarshan channels (DD-1, DD- regional channels, DD-India, DD-Bharti) have been telecasting recorded plays of good directors from long. Many plays from Patna and Delhi theatre have been telecasted on national channels.  DD regional channels Bihar and Bhopal (MP) regularly presents recorded plays. Doordarshan national channels have been telecasting theatre groups’ play and these plays getting wider audiences. The nomenclature of recorded play ‘CinePlay’ is new but not the format.

Almost all the world classics are available on you tube.  Many theatre group, educational institutions, Drama Schools have uploaded their video in part/ full on you tube. These uploads qualify the definition of CinePlay.

Do I enjoy CinePlay?

Frankly speaking – No & Yes. I find it is very cumbersome to see recorded plays. I enjoy watching play live. That enjoyment CinePlay cannot give at any cost. However, I confess, the plays that I performed, or the plays I watched live and like it – I love watching recorded version too. I saw the plays of famous Surabhi theatre Group (AP) on DD national three years ago. I got exposure of hundred-year-old theatre group through recorded version. Hope, I will get the opportunity to see the group’s performance soon.

I have been moderately involved in Hyderabad theatre and feeling a part of theatre fraternity. Being a part of theatre fraternity, I feel that Hyderabad theatre has very little exposure to theatre of other places. Patna, Bhopal, Mumbai & Delhi have done many experiments in theatre and produced a good number of national and international productions. Hope, Hyderabad theatre will have good exposure of theatre from different part of our country through CinePlay. If it happens, Cineplay will do real service in theatre to this city.
